2. Smart Plug: The Simplest Way to Declutter Your Setup
You don’t need to replace all your devices to create a smart apartment.
A simple smart plug can transform your existing appliances and reduce control clutter immediately.
I personally use the Kasa Smart Plug HS103 because it’s compact, reliable, and easy to install. No complicated setup required.

How a smart plug helps in a small apartment:
- Control lamps without adding extra switches
- Schedule your coffee maker
- Turn devices off remotely
- Reduce phantom power usage
- Eliminate multiple timers and remotes
Instead of having scattered extension cords and switches everywhere, you manage everything from one app.
Small Apartment Trick: Connect your TV, gaming console, and router to one power strip plugged into the smart plug. One tap at night shuts everything down. Cleaner look. Less clutter.
3. Air Purifier + Fan Combo: Cleaner Air Without Extra Bulk
Air quality is more noticeable in small apartments because airflow is limited. Cooking smells linger longer. Dust circulates faster. And when windows are small, ventilation can be weak.
Instead of buying both a fan and an air purifier, choose a device that combines both functions.
I like the Dyson Pure Cool TP07 because it works as a purifier and cooling fan in one slim design.
Why this works so well in compact living:
- It replaces two appliances
- It has a slim vertical footprint
- Helps reduce dust accumulation
- Improves overall air freshness
- Keeps your room feeling lighter and more breathable
In small living, multi-functional tech is everything. If one item can do two jobs, it’s worth considering.

The Golden Rule of Small Apartment Tech
Before buying any gadget, ask yourself:
- Does it replace something I already own?
- Does it reduce visual clutter?
- Does it save space?
- Does it serve more than one purpose?
- Will it simplify my daily routine?
If the answer is no to most of these, skip it.
Small apartment living is about intentional choices, not filling empty corners.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Buying Tech for Small Spaces
- Buying oversized devices without measuring
- Adding gadgets instead of replacing old ones
- Ignoring vertical space
- Focusing only on aesthetics instead of function
Remember: clean lines and open floor space create the illusion of a larger home.
